The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 90045 zip code. The total population is 41411, of which, 19622 are male and 21789 are female. With a total area of 27.793 square miles, the population density is 1459.6 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 35.5 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 90045 zip code is $152218. This is 74.65% greater than the national average. This income places 6.7%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$39916. Education
In the 90045 zip code, 96.5%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 60.1%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 90045 zip, there are an estimated 23257 people in the labor force, of which, 21745 are employed, and 1462 are unemployed. There are a total of 50 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 26.9 minutes. Of the total people that work, 4730 worked from home and 21130 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 37.2. Housing
The median home value for the 90045 zip code is 1103500. There is an estimated 15666 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$2542 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$2524.
